Three approaches to the Howe duality between quantum general linear supergroups

Abstract

The Howe duality between quantum general linear supergroups was firstly established by Y. Zhang via quantum coordinate superalgebras. In this paper, we provide two other approaches to this Howe duality. One is constructed by quantum differential operators, while the other is based on the Beilinson-Lusztig-MacPherson realization of Uq(glmn)U_q(\mathfrak{gl}_{m|n}). Moreover, we show that these three approaches are equivalent by giving their action formulas explicitly.
